Welcome to day 7 of #LibFaves25: THE CORRESPONDENT by Virginia Evans, a masterful word-of-mouth debut about a chronic letter-writer, a story told entirely in letters and emails. Sybil, the smart, curious, opinionated, an stubborn main character, is one of this years most delightful discoveries.

#LibFaves25 Today I will rave about WILD DARK SHORE by Charlotte McConaghy. A cold dark tale of chaos. A woman comes to Antarctica to find her husband and instead finds a family of caretakers and so many secrets. Wild, mysterious and cautionary all in one.
